Why Traditional Maintenance Struggles
Manufacturers often juggle spreadsheets, dusty CMMS modules, and tribal knowledge scribbled in notebooks. That scattered information leads to:
- Unplanned downtime when critical alerts slip through the cracks.
- Repeat faults because yesterday’s fix is lost in email threads.
- Slow onboarding as new engineers hunt clues across silos.
Without a unified system, teams spend more time firefighting than improving. It’s a cycle of reactive patches rather than proactive upgrades—and it drives up costs every time a line stops.

A Practical Roadmap to AI-Driven Maintenance
- Audit your current processes and identify top bottlenecks.
- Consolidate asset and work order data for a clean baseline.
- Deploy iMaintain alongside existing tools—no downtime.
- Train engineers on the new assisted workflows and AI insights.
- Monitor KPIs, refine templates, and expand predictive triggers.
This phased approach keeps your team engaged and builds trust in AI, rather than scaring people with overnight transformation. Over weeks, not months, you’ll shift from chasing breakdowns to preventing them.
Choosing the Right Maintenance Software
When evaluating platforms, watch for solutions that:
- Prioritise human-centred AI over black-box predictions.
- Preserve and surface the expertise you already have.
- Offer modular integration paths with your CMMS and production systems.
- Provide clear visibility for both engineers and leadership.
